Abstract: We use coupling ideas introduced in cite{levine2018long} to show that an IDLA process on a cylinder graph GimesmathbbZ forgets a typical initial profile in mathcalO(NsqrtauN(log!N)2) steps for large N, where N is the size of the base graph G, and auN is the total variation mixing time of a simple random walk on G. The main new ingredient is a maximal fluctuations bound for IDLA on GimesmathbbZ which only relies on the mixing properties of the base graph G and the Abelian property.
